- FOCUS (Fire Operational Characteristics Using Simulation) is a computer simulation model for evaluating alternative fire management plans. This final report provides a broad overview of the FOCUS system, describes two major modules-fire suppression and cost, explains the role in the system of gaming large fires, and outlines the support programs and ways of implementing the system. - In 1962, the Management Sciences Staff was organized in Berkeley, Calif., as the internal consultant to the Forest Service, U.S. Department of Agriculture. From then until 1979, the Staff conducted 41 major studies. Although the rate of implementing recommendations from these studies was high, a more formal self-assessment was considered advisable. The following six case studies with the largest investment were analyzed: size of Ranger Districts, solid waste management, radio telecommunications design and management, computer support systems, ADVENT, and rock aggregates transport. - A total of 56 photographs shows different levels of natural fuel loadings for selected size classes in seven forest types of the southern Cascade and northern Sierra-Nevada ranges. Data provided with each photo include size, weight, volumes, residue depths, and percent of ground coverage. - This guide provides instructions for the use of POLO2, a computer program for multivariate probit or logic analysis of quantal response data. As many as 3000 test subjects may be included in a single analysis. Including the constant term, up to nine explanatory variables may be used. - Water repellency in soils was first described by Schreiner and Shorey (1910), who found that some soils in California could not be wetted and thereby were not suitable for agriculture. Waxy organic substances were responsible for the water repellency. Other studies in the early 1900's on the fairy ring phenomenon suggested that water repellency could be caused by fungi. These fairy rings created unsightly, circular shaped areas in otherwise healthy turf and lawn. - Native oak species grow on 15 to 20 million acres (6 to 8 million ha) of California land, and have an estimated net volume of about 3 billion ft3 (85 million m3). This resource, valuable not only for traditional wood products, but also for wildlife habitat, watershed protection, and recreational-esthetic values, is not effectively managed, partly because of a lack of silvicultural and other management knowledge. - Caribbean pine is an important exotic being bred throughout the tropics, but published estimates are lacking for heritability of economically important traits and the genetic correlations between them. Based on a Puerto Rican trial of 16 open-pollinated parents of var. hondurensis selected in Belize, heritabilities for a number of characteristics ranged from 0.04 to 0.53. Volume had a moderate heritability of 0.11 while bark thickness had a high heritability of 0.53. - When grown in a common environment, the progeny of white pine (Pinus strobus L.) from weeviled stands improved by selection thinning outperformed the progeny of wolfy dominants from untreated stands in both height and weevil resistance. Within families, weevils tended to attack the tallest trees. Among families the relationship was not as strong and actually reversed during the last year of measurement. Therefore, it is possible to select for weevil resistance without sacrificing height growth. - Abstract - Erosion and site conditions were measured at 102 logged plots in northwestern California. Erosion averaged 26.8 m 3 /ha. A log-normal distribution was a better fit to the data. The antilog of the mean of the logarithms of erosion was 3.2 m 3 /ha. The Coast District Erosion Hazard Rating was a poor predictor of erosion related to logging. - Abstract - Root decay after timber cutting can lead to slope failure. In situ measurements of soil with tree roots showed that soil strength increased linearly as root biomass increased. Forests clear-felled 3 years earlier contained about one-third of the root biomass of old-growth forests. Nearly all of the roots < 2 mm in diameter were gone from 7-year-old logged areas while about 30 percent of the < 17 mm fraction was found. Extensive brushfields occupied areas logged 12 to 24 years earlier.
